Master IT Hardware, Software, and Troubleshooting--and Fully Prepare for the Latest CompTIA® Core 1 and Core 2 Exams (V15)
The Complete A+ Guide to IT Hardware and Software is your all-in-one, real-world, full-color resource for building the skills you need to become a confident, job-ready IT technician--and for passing the updated CompTIA A+ Core 1 and Core 2 Exams (V15).
Built around the latest A+ exam objectives, this comprehensive guide helps you connect, configure, manage, and troubleshoot today's most widely used devices, operating systems, and cloud-based technologies--all in the context of real IT scenarios. You'll gain hands-on expertise with Windows 11, macOS, Linux, Chrome OS, Android, iOS, mobile and IoT devices, Active Directory, cybersecurity, scripting, and more.
Award-winning instructors Cheryl Schmidt and Christopher Lee combine technical depth with a strong focus on customer service and workplace-ready soft skills. Legacy technologies are also covered to prepare you for any environment you may encounter in the field.
